County Accepts Help With July 4th Festival

By Valerie Baldowski
Henry Daily Herald
June 24, 2010

This year’s Georgia Independence Day Festival, in Henry County, was in jeopardy of being canceled, due to county budget cuts. A local television station, however, has provided the money needed to rescue the annual event.

During a special called meeting on Thursday, the Henry County Board of Commissioners approved an agreement for co-sponsorship of the festival. Under the agreement, Signature Broadcasting Networks LLC, (SBN-TV), based in McDonough, will pay a sponsorship fee of $25,170 to the county.

The commission also approved a contract with Atlanta Pyrotechnics International, Inc., based in Marietta, to provide fireworks for the festival. The cost for the fireworks will be $15,000, and the money will be drawn from the county’s Parks and Recreation Department budget.
